Realme 14T 8/128Gb vs Blackview A80s: Antutu benchmark comparison.
Realme 14T 8/128Gb in the AnTuTu benchmark test got 370117 score points which is 364.60% faster than the Blackview A80s, which got 79664. You can compare its ranking and performance with other models results based on the Antutu test below.
Realme 14T 8/128Gb vs Blackview A80s: Geekbench benchmark comparison.
Realme 14T 8/128Gb in the Geekbench benchmark tests got a 658 points score in "Single-core" of against the Blackview A80s which got 157, it is 319.11% faster. In "Multi-core" score 1927 vs 782 (146.42% faster). You can compare its ranking and performance with other models results based on the Geekbench test below.
What is the difference between Realme 14T 8/128Gb and Blackview A80s? (compare specs) (which is better)
The main differences, why it is better to choose the Realme 14T 8/128Gb (advantages)
- Good performance: Is 364.60% faster in the Antutu test (290453 score difference).
- Has a higher resolution newer rear camera: 50Mp Omnivision OV50D40 Light Hunter 400 compared to 13Mp Sony IMX258
- Has a higher resolution front (selfie) camera: 16Mp vs 5Mp .
- NFC supports.
- Has a higher screen resolution: 2400x1080 vs 1560x720.
- More battery capacity: 6000mAh vs 4200mAh (a difference of 1800mAh).
- Have water resistant supports.
- Have fast charging supports.
Why it is better not to take Realme 14T 8/128Gb (disadvantages)
- Does not have Headphone Jack. Need audio 3.5mm headphone jack adapter
The main differences, why it is better to choose the Blackview A80s (advantages)
- Best weight: 16 grams less (180 vs 196).
- Have headphone Jack. 3.5mm supports.
Why it is better not to take Blackview A80s (disadvantages)
- Does not support NFC.
- Does not have water resistant supports.
- Does not have fast charging support
